Parameter Descriptions

11-47

Important:

When this function is enabled, the following conditions

must be met:

A proper minimum value must be set for Sleep Level

(182).

At least one of the following must be programmed in

Digital Inx Sel (361 to 366): Enable,
Stop=CF, Run, Run Forward, Run Reverse.

Sleep-Wake Operation

The basic operation of this function is to start (wake) the drive when
an analog signal is greater than or equal to a user-specified wake
level and stop the drive when an analog signal is less than or equal
to a user-specified sleep level.

Assuming all drive permissive conditions are met, the drive will start
when Sleep-Wake Mode (178) is enabled (= Direct) and the
absolute value of the Sleep-Wake Ref (179) is greater than the
programmed Wake Level (180) for longer than the programmed
Wake Time (181).

The drive will stop when the absolute value of the Sleep-Wake Ref
(179) is less than the programmed Sleep Level (182) for longer than
the programmed Sleep Time (183).

While the drive is measuring the time above Wake Level (180), it will
indicate a "Waking" alarm. If Sleep-Wake Ref (179) goes above
Sleep Level (182) or below Wake Level (180) the corresponding
timer is reset (Wake timer and Sleep timer, respectively).

While the drive is "awake", all other active stop commands will be
honored immediately (i.e. no Sleep timer). However, after a stop is
commanded, a new start command while Sleep-Wake Ref (179) is
above Sleep Level (182) will be required to reset the sleep-wake
controller. Similarly, while the drive is “asleep”, the selected logic
control source can still start the drive. In this case, the sleep-wake
controller must also be reset (stop, then restart with analog input
above sleep level).
